def create_to_binary_s_code(nbits, endian, signed)
  # special case 8bit integers for speed
  return "(val & 0xff).chr" if nbits == 8
  bits_per_word = bytes_per_word(nbits) * 8
  nwords        = nbits / bits_per_word
  mask          = (1 << bits_per_word) - 1
  vals = (0 ... nwords).collect do |i|
           i.zero? ? "val" : "val >> #{bits_per_word * i}"
         end
  vals.reverse! if (endian == :big)
  array_str = "[" + vals.collect { |val| "#{val} & #{mask}" }.join(", ") + "]" # TODO: "& mask" is needed to work around jruby bug
  pack_str  = "#{array_str}.pack('#{pack_directive(nbits, endian, signed)}')"
  if need_conversion_code?(nbits, signed)
    "#{create_int2uint_code(nbits)} ; #{pack_str}"
  else
    pack_str
  end
end
